Berkshire Launches Early Intervention in Psychosis Service

The Berkshire Early Intervention in Psychosis (EIP) Launch Event took place on the 15 June 2016. The purpose of the event was to recognise and celebrate the launch of a stand-alone EIP service working across the whole of Berkshire to support those experiencing First Episode Psychosis (FEP) or with At Risk Mental States (ARMS).

For people experiencing the early stages of a psychotic illness, the Berkshire EIP Service offers three core functions:

1. Early detection;
2. Acute care during and immediately following a crisis;
3. Recovery-focused continuing care, featuring multimodal interventions to enable people to maintain or regain their social, academic, and career trajectory.
